web前端分离:解析其深层含义与影响

web前端分离:解析其深层含义与影响

在现今的web开发领域,前端分离已经成为一个不可忽视的趋势。那么,web前端分离究竟意味着什么呢?本文将从四个方面、五个方面、六个方面和七个方面,深入剖析其内涵,并探讨其带来的困惑与爆发性影响。

一、四个方面:前端分离的基本概念与特点

前端分离,顾名思义,是指将web应用的前端部分与后端部分进行分离开发。这种开发模式的特点在于,前端负责呈现界面和交互逻辑,而后端则专注于数据处理和rmrbggkd.com业务逻辑。这种分离使得前端和后端可以独立开发、测试和维护,提高了开发效率和质量。

二、五个方面:前端分离的技术实现

实现前端分离需要借助一系列的技术手段。首先,前端框架 如React、Vue等提供了丰富的组件和工具,使得前端开发者能够更高效地构建复杂的界面和交互逻辑。其次,前后端通信协议 如RESTful API、GraphQL等,实现了前端与后端之间的数据交换。此外,模块化开发前端路由管理 以及状态管理等技术也为前端分离提供了有力支持。

三、六个方面:前端分离带来的困惑与挑战

尽管前端分离带来了诸多优势,但同时也带来了一些困惑和挑战。首先,前端开发者需要具备一定的后端知识,以便更好地理解业务逻辑和数据结构。其次,前后端分离可能导致接口设计和数据传输的问题,需要双方密切协作和沟通。此外,前端性能的优化和兼容性问题也是需要考虑的重要因素。

四、七个方面:前端分离的爆发性影响

前端分离的普及和发展对web开发领域产生了爆发性的影响。首先,它推动了前端技术的快速发展和创新,使得前端开发者能够更加专注于界面和www.rmrbggkd.com交互的设计和实现。其次,前端分离提高了开发效率和团队协作效率,使得项目能够更快地迭代和发布。此外,前端分离还促进了前后端团队的独立性和专业性,使得各自能够更好地发挥专长和优势。

综上所述,web前端分离意味着前端与后端的分离开发模式,它带来了技术实现上的便利和优势,同时也带来了一些困惑和挑战。然而,随着技术的不断发展和完善,我们有理由相信前端分离将在未来的web开发中扮演更加重要的角色,并推动整个行业的进步和发展。

相关推荐
ai大师9 分钟前
(附代码及图示)Multi-Query 多查询策略详解
python·langchain·中转api·apikey·中转apikey·免费apikey·claude4
小小爬虾30 分钟前
关于datetime获取时间的问题
python
蓝婷儿2 小时前
6个月Python学习计划 Day 16 - 面向对象编程(OOP)基础
开发语言·python·学习
chao_7892 小时前
链表题解——两两交换链表中的节点【LeetCode】
数据结构·python·leetcode·链表
大霞上仙3 小时前
nonlocal 与global关键字
开发语言·python
Mark_Aussie3 小时前
Flask-SQLAlchemy使用小结
python·flask
程序员阿龙3 小时前
【精选】计算机毕业设计Python Flask海口天气数据分析可视化系统 气象数据采集处理 天气趋势图表展示 数据可视化平台源码+论文+PPT+讲解
python·flask·课程设计·数据可视化系统·天气数据分析·海口气象数据·pandas 数据处理
ZHOU_WUYI4 小时前
Flask与Celery 项目应用(shared_task使用)
后端·python·flask
忠于明白4 小时前
Spring AI 核心工作流
人工智能·spring·大模型应用开发·spring ai·ai 应用商业化
且慢.5894 小时前
Python_day47
python·深度学习·计算机视觉